7 на первых порах
[PrepP; Invar; adv; fixed WO]=====⇒ during the initial period (of some activity, process, s.o.'s stay somewhere etc):- at first;- early on.♦ Одам инстинктивно боялся перемен... Убежав из племени, совершив поступок грандиозный и революционный, он пытался тотчас как бы забыть начисто об этом и жить как можно более похоже на то, как жилось ему раньше. На первых порах он стал даже более косным, чем был прежде (Обухова 1). Odam instinctively feared any changes....Having left the tribe, having committed a stupendous, revolutionary act, he tried, as it were, to forget it as completely as he could and live as much as possible as he had lived before. In the beginning, he had even become more rigid in his ways than he had been before (1a).♦ Я до того испугался неожиданного появления отца, что даже на первых порах не заметил, откуда он шёл и куда исчез (Тургенев 3). I was so frightened by my father's unexpected appearance that at first I did not even notice whence he had come or where he went (3c).♦ "Не могу врать..." - "Надо научиться"... Но на первых порах я была не очень понятливой ученицей... (Гинзбург 1). "Well, I can't tell lies." "Then you had better learn, hadn't you?"...At the start I showed little talent... (1a).Большой русско-английский фразеологический словарь > на первых порах

9 ангел во плоти
уст.an angel incorporate, an angel upon earth; an absolute angel- Ведь вам говорить нечего - вы знаете, что у меня за жена: ангел во плоти, доброта неизъяснимая. (И. Тургенев, Записки охотника) — 'I need not tell you - you know what my wife is; an angel upon earth, goodness inexhaustible.'
- Ну, мог ли я в свои годы, при своей такой наружности, надеяться, что эта достойная девушка не побрезгует стать моей... матерью моих сироток? Ведь она красавица, как изволили вы видеть, ангел во плоти! (А. Чехов, Драма на охоте) — 'How could I, at my age, with my appearance, hope that this deserving girl would not disdain to become mine... the mother of my orphan children? Why, she's a beauty, as you have been pleased to notice, an angel incorporate!'
